What Are Some Affordable Ways to Create a Secluded Outdoor Oasis?

June 5, 2023

Creating a tranquil outdoor space doesn’t have to break the bank—there are several affordable ways to transform your backyard or patio into a cozy outdoor oasis. One way is to use plants to create a natural barrier and add privacy. Lighting is another great option for setting the mood and creating a cozy atmosphere in your yard. In addition, there are plenty of DIY projects that you can do to make custom features for your outdoor sanctuary.  

How to Build a Cozy Oasis on a Budget  

  1. Use Plants to Enhance the Space: From fast-growing shrubs to tall bamboo, many types of plants can be used to create a natural barrier and add privacy and greenery to your outdoor space.   
  2. Set the Mood with Lighting: String lights, lanterns, and solar-powered path lights can create a cozy atmosphere without draining your wallet.   
  3. DIY Custom Features and Furniture: From building a fire pit to repurposing old pallets into seating, there are plenty of DIY projects that can add character and functionality to your outdoor space. Check out hardware store sales, online community marketplaces and used furniture stores to find the best deals.
